While digital adoption continues to grow, a significant portion of the population still prefers physical mail—particularly for financial and utility communications. The hybrid approach—offering both paper and digital bill delivery—is now becoming standard for many utilities.

Professional bill printing and mailing services support this transition by providing multi-channel delivery systems. Whether a customer wants a PDF via email or a printed bill through the postal service, these platforms ensure seamless distribution across preferred channels.
This approach also supports inclusivity, especially for customers in rural or underserved areas who may lack reliable internet access. Offering paper billing options alongside digital ensures that all customer needs are met without exclusion.
Moreover, with integrated data tools, utility companies can analyze user preferences and optimize delivery accordingly. Some customers may choose paper bills for recordkeeping, while others may prefer digital formats for convenience. Flexibility enhances engagement and reduces service friction.
Incorporating both methods also serves as a safety net during outages, cyber incidents, or digital system downtimes. Physical mail ensures continuity in customer communications when digital channels fail.
